THERMAL ANALYSIS OF A POLYPHENYL-as-TRIAZINE,
Abstract
A well-characterized poly(phenyl-as-triazine) was pyrolysed under dynamic and isothermal conditions in vacuum and in air. Simultaneous thermogravimetric, differential thermal and thermobarometric analysis of polymer films indicate a multistage thermal decomposition. An exothermic reaction between 305 and 465C was shown to involve the asymmetric triazine ring. This leads to the formation of a stable intermediate symmetrical triazine and nitrilic products, primarily benzonitrile. Based on the data, a degradation scheme initially involving the scission of the nitrogen-nitrogen bond in the asymmetric triazine ring was postulated. (Author)
